In the UK, curators play a vital role in managing and developing collections for museums, galleries, and other cultural institutions. Aspiring curators can expect a 20% share in the job market, with an average salary ranging from £22,000 to £40,000 per year. Art directors, on the other hand, oversee the visual style and images in various media such as print, television, and theater. This role commands a 15% share in the job market, with a typical salary range of £30,000 to £60,000 per year. Museum technicians and conservators ensure the preservation and maintenance of art collections and artifacts in museums and galleries. This role has a 10% share in the job market, with an average salary ranging from £16,000 to £30,000 per year.
